"Kick the Bottle"
Sunday, 10 October, 2010 - 14:30 - 16:30
The League of Women Voters-Arlington Area (LWVAA), in conjunction with the UTA Environmental Society and other student and faculty volunteers, and the Arlington Conservation Council (ACC) have planned a "Kick the Bottle" project to begin immediately with water "taste tests" at festivals and other events around town. Having compared, we will urge people to sign a pledge to avoid bottled water when tap water is available. This project will culminate on October 10, 2010 with a viewing of the award-winning documentary Tapped (Stephanie Soechtig and Jason Lindsey, Atlas Films, 2009) at 2:30 at UTA, in the Lone Star Auditorium (inside the MAC) where we will take a photo for 350.org

Event Host: The League of Women Voters-Arlington Area is a nonpartisan political organization that encourages the informed and active participation of citizens in government and influences public policy through education and advocacy.
